#include <UWSimUtils.h>
Public Member Functions | |
virtual void | apply (osg::Node &searchNode) |
findNodeVisitor () | |
findNodeVisitor (const std::string &searchName) | |
osg::Node * | getFirst () |
nodeListType & | getNodeList () |
void | setNameToFind (const std::string &searchName) |
Private Attributes | |
nodeListType | foundNodeList |
std::string | searchForName |
Definition at line 61 of file UWSimUtils.h.
Definition at line 33 of file UWSimUtils.cpp.
findNodeVisitor::findNodeVisitor | ( | const std::string & | searchName | ) |
Definition at line 41 of file UWSimUtils.cpp.
void findNodeVisitor::apply | ( | osg::Node & | searchNode | ) | [virtual] |
Definition at line 49 of file UWSimUtils.cpp.
osg::Node * findNodeVisitor::getFirst | ( | ) |
Definition at line 66 of file UWSimUtils.cpp.
nodeListType& findNodeVisitor::getNodeList | ( | ) | [inline] |
Definition at line 75 of file UWSimUtils.h.
void findNodeVisitor::setNameToFind | ( | const std::string & | searchName | ) |
Definition at line 60 of file UWSimUtils.cpp.
nodeListType findNodeVisitor::foundNodeList [private] |
Definition at line 83 of file UWSimUtils.h.
std::string findNodeVisitor::searchForName [private] |
Definition at line 82 of file UWSimUtils.h.